Output 66767a0b90313717a7455546de64282ea1edb27457304b95c5b4a2782e256954:26

value
521494
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d1b638937eafcb098d81e53346ba8562e4c723f0 OP_EQUAL
address
3LosSaD9gQk8LVvbVEwCiBdh94phDoqEB7
transaction
66767a0b90313717a7455546de64282ea1edb27457304b95c5b4a2782e256954
spent
true